Golden Mouth (2019): A Crime Drama Unraveled — Full Movie Info
Golden Mouth (2019) dives into the legend of a Rio de Janeiro crime boss whose nickname came from his glittering golden teeth. Directed by Daniel Filho, this gripping drama unfolds through conflicting accounts of his life, all narrated posthumously by his former lover to the press. The film blends crime and drama, exploring themes of power, memory, and the many faces of truth, all set against the vibrant yet dangerous backdrop of 1980s Rio. With a tone that oscillates between gritty realism and darkly poetic storytelling, it challenges viewers to question which version of Golden Mouth's life is the most authentic.
Starring Marcos Palmeira in the title role, alongside Sílvio Guindane and Malu Mader, the cast delivers raw, emotionally charged performances that bring the morally complex world of Golden Mouth to life. The film's tight 93-minute runtime keeps the tension high, while its layered narrative invites reflection on loyalty, betrayal, and the mythmaking that surrounds infamous figures.
